The relationship between gut microbiota and cancer immune response and immunotherapy

Abstract:
The gut microbiota critically regulates cancer immunity and immunotherapy outcomes. It does so through complex, bidirectional interactions with the host immune system. Key microbial metabolites drive this process. These include short-chain fatty acids (SCFAs), tryptophan derivatives, inosine, trimethylamine N-oxide (TMAO), and bile acids. These molecules direct immune cell differentiation and activity via pattern recognition receptor signaling and epigenetic regulation. Clinical studies have linked specific microbial compositions to responses to immune checkpoint inhibitors (ICIs) across multiple cancer types. These studies also highlight a dual role of the microbiota. It can both increase therapeutic efficacy and mitigate immune-related adverse events (irAEs). Several therapeutic strategies are under active investigation. These include fecal microbiota transplantation (FMT), probiotics, prebiotics, and dietary interventions. However, challenges remain regarding engraftment, standardization, and formulation consistency. Large-scale, well-designed studies are still needed. Such studies will help establish the gut microbiota as a reliable prognostic biomarker and a viable therapeutic adjunct in cancer immunotherapy.
